61/ Jordan showcases at Tripoli International Fair, eyes stronger trade ties with Libya
Amman, April 23 (Petra) – Jordan Exports organized the kingdom’s participation in the 51st Tripoli International Fair in Libya, featuring 40 Jordanian companies from a range of economic sectors. According to a statement released Wednesday, the Jordanian pavilion attracted significant attention from Libyan and Arab visitors, including businessmen and investors. The Jordanian delegation, led by Jordan Exports CEO Yousef Shamali, held a series of meetings aimed at strengthening bilateral relations and exploring cooperation opportunities particularly in construction, services, food products, and pharmaceuticals. Both Jordanian and Libyan officials reaffirmed the depth of ties between the two countries and expressed a shared commitment to enhancing cooperation across multiple fields. The delegation included Fathi Jaghbir, President of the Jordan and Amman Chambers of Industry, and Omar Jwaid, director general of the Jordan Industrial Estates Company. The group also met with several senior Libyan officials, including Minister of Transport Mohamed Al-Shahoubi, Minister of Housing Abu Bakr Al-Ghawi, Minister of Economy and Trade Mohamed Al-Huwaij, and Mohamed Al-Raied, President of the Libyan Union of Chambers of Commerce, Industry, and Agriculture. Meetings were also held with the head of the Libyan Telecommunications Holding Company and other government officials and business leaders. //Petra// AF
